This is the most westerly point of the British Mainland, a secluded corner on the west coast, and one of the most beautiful and unspoilt areas of Scotland with its lovely sheltered sea lochs dotted with small islands and the wooded hills rising steeply from the shores. The village of Arivegaig can be found on the north coast of the Ardnamurchan peninsula.

Discover the uninhabited beaches of Singing Sands and Sanna Bay, go fishing on rivers, hill lochs, and sea lochs, and take in some of the most breath-taking scenery in the world on the Ardnamurchan peninsula, which is famous for its many outdoor attractions and activities.

Discover the majestic ruins of Castle Tioram, and don't forget to bring your camera so you can capture the abundant bird life and diverse range of flora and wildlife.

You will find that this area has a rich history that dates all the way back to the time of the Vikings.

The village of Salen can be found on the road that leads to Ardnamurchan point, which is the most westerly point on the British mainland. It overlooks Salen Bay, which is an inlet of the sea loch known as Loch Sunart, and it is an excellent place to purchase a vacation home because it has a village shop, a hotel that looks out over the breathtaking Loch Sunart, and a jetty with public moorings. The primary access route from Salen is a winding single-track road that follows the shore of Loch Sunart for the most of its length. After leaving Salen, travellers must travel to the west and travel through an ancient oak wood while taking in breathtaking views of the loch.

Both a natural history centre and a nature trail maintained by the RSPB can be found in this area. There are numerous beautiful walks in the area, such as the Salen Alphabet Trail and the Salen Woods, which goes around Salen Bay and passes through Atlantic oak woodland.

Fort William is approximately 75 kilometres (47 miles) away from Salen. Fort William is home to a multitude of amenities, including a variety of stores, supermarkets, medical and dental facilities, secondary and primary schools, the Lochaber college, and a variety of recreational and sporting facilities. Salen is located approximately 47 miles away. The region of Lochaber is known as the "Outdoor Capital of the UK," and it is acclaimed for the numerous options it provides for inhabitants and visitors to explore the enormous wilderness on foot, by car, by motorbike, by mountain bike, or by boat.

There is a diverse selection of outdoor activities available in the region, including those offered by the Nevis Range Outdoor Pursuits Centre, which is located within a ten-minute drive of Fort William.
